LibreNMS before 24.10.0 allows a remote attacker to execute arbitrary code via OS command injection involving AboutController.php's index(), SettingsController.php's update(), and PollDevice.php's initRrdDirectory().

LibreNMS versions before 26.3.0 are affected by an authenticated remote code execution vulnerability by abusing the Binary Locations config and the Netcommand feature. Successful exploitation requires administrative privileges. Exploitation could result in compromise of the underlying web server.

LibreNMS is an auto-discovering PHP/MySQL/SNMP based network monitoring tool. Versions 25.12.0 and below contain an SQL Injection vulnerability in the ajax_table.php endpoint. The application fails to properly sanitize or parameterize user input when processing IPv6 address searches. Specifically, the address parameter is split into an address and a prefix, and the prefix portion is directly concatenated into the SQL query string without validation. This allows an attacker to inject arbitrary SQL commands, potentially leading to unauthorized data access or database manipulation. This issue has been fixed in version 26.2.0.

LibreNMS 1.46 contains an authenticated SQL injection vulnerability in the MAC accounting graph endpoint that allows remote attackers to extract database information. Attackers can exploit the vulnerability by manipulating the 'sort' parameter with crafted SQL injection techniques to retrieve sensitive database contents through time-based blind SQL injection.

LibreNMS is an auto-discovering PHP/MySQL/SNMP based network monitoring tool. Prior to version 25.12.0, the Alert Rule API is vulnerable to stored cross-site scripting. Alert rules can be created or updated via LibreNMS API. The alert rule name is not properly sanitized, and can be used to inject HTML code. This issue has been patched in version 25.12.0.

LibreNMS is an auto-discovering PHP/MySQL/SNMP based network monitoring tool. Prior to version 25.11.0, a reflected cross-site scripting (XSS) vulnerability was identified in the LibreNMS application at the /maps/nodeimage endpoint. The Image Name parameter is reflected in the HTTP response without proper output encoding or sanitization, allowing an attacker to craft a URL that, when visited by a victim, causes arbitrary JavaScript execution in the victim’s browser. This issue has been patched in version 25.11.0.

LibreNMS is a community-based GPL-licensed network monitoring system. LibreNMS <= 25.8.0 contains a Stored Cross-Site Scripting (XSS) vulnerability in the Alert Transports management functionality. When an administrator creates a new Alert Transport, the value of the Transport name field is stored and later rendered in the Transports column of the Alert Rules page without proper input validation or output encoding. This leads to arbitrary JavaScript execution in the admin’s browser. This vulnerability is fixed in 25.10.0.

LibreNMS is an open-source, PHP/MySQL/SNMP-based network monitoring system. Prior to 25.7.0, there is a reflected-XSS in `report_this` function in `librenms/includes/functions.php`. The `report_this` function had improper filtering (`htmlentities` function was incorrectly use in a href environment), which caused the `project_issues` parameter to trigger an XSS vulnerability. This vulnerability is fixed in 25.7.0.

librenms is a community-based GPL-licensed network monitoring system. A stored Cross-Site Scripting (XSS) vulnerability exists in LibreNMS (<= 25.6.0) in the Alert Template creation feature. This allows a user with the admin role to inject malicious JavaScript, which will be executed when the template is rendered, potentially compromising other admin accounts. This vulnerability is fixed in 25.8.0.

LibreNMS is an auto-discovering PHP/MySQL/SNMP based network monitoring which includes support for a wide range of network hardware and operating systems. LibreNMS versions 25.6.0 and below contain an architectural vulnerability in the ajax_form.php endpoint that permits Remote File Inclusion based on user-controlled POST input. The application directly uses the type parameter to dynamically include .inc.php files from the trusted path includes/html/forms/, without validation or allowlisting. This pattern introduces a latent Remote Code Execution (RCE) vector if an attacker can stage a file in this include path — for example, via symlink, development misconfiguration, or chained vulnerabilities. This is fixed in version 25.7.0.

LibreNMS is PHP/MySQL/SNMP based network monitoring software. LibreNMS v25.4.0 and prior suffers from a Stored Cross-Site Scripting (XSS) Vulnerability in the `group name` parameter of the `http://localhost/poller/groups` form. This vulnerability allows attackers to inject malicious scripts into web pages viewed by other users. LibreNMS v25.5.0 contains a patch for the issue.

librenms is a community-based GPL-licensed network monitoring system. Affected versions are subject to Cross-site Scripting (XSS) on the parameters:`/addhost` -> param: community. Librenms versions up to 24.10.1 allow remote attackers to inject malicious scripts. When a user views or interacts with the page displaying the data, the malicious script executes immediately, leading to potential unauthorized actions or data exposure. This issue has been addressed in release version 24.11.0. Users are advised to upgrade. There are no known workarounds for this vulnerability.

Stored XSS in LibreNMS Device Settings Display Name

CVE-2024-53457 is a stored cross-site scripting (XSS) flaw in the Device Settings section of the LibreNMS network monitoring platform, versions v24.9.0 through v24.10.0. An authenticated user with access to device settings can inject a crafted payload into the Display Name parameter, and the malicious script or HTML is then persistently stored and executed when other users view the affected device page. An attacker gains the ability to run arbitrary web scripts in the browsers of other LibreNMS users, under the application's origin, which can be used for session or credential theft and other client-side attacks given the low-privilege, user-interaction requirements reflected in the CVSS score. Organizations running LibreNMS v24.9.0 to v24.10.0 are affected; instances on older or newer releases fall outside the published range. A public proof-of-concept exists and EPSS assigns a high ~44% probability of exploitation within 30 days, but the flaw is not yet in CISA KEV and there is no confirmed in-the-wild exploitation.

Do: Upgrade LibreNMS to a release newer than v24.10.0, which exits the affected range. In the meantime, restrict who can edit Device Settings, review stored device Display Names for embedded HTML/script payloads, and ensure output escaping of the Display Name field is applied if patching is delayed.

Stored XSS in LibreNMS API-Access page risks session hijack

LibreNMS, an open-source PHP/MySQL/SNMP network monitoring system, contains a stored cross-site scripting (XSS) flaw (CWE-79) in its API-Access page. An authenticated user with low privileges can embed arbitrary JavaScript in the token field when creating a new API token; the payload is saved and later executes in the browsers of other users who view that page, requiring user interaction to trigger. Successful exploitation runs attacker-supplied code in the context of other users' sessions, which can lead to account compromise and unauthorized actions within the monitoring platform. All LibreNMS deployments running versions prior to 24.10.0 are affected. The flaw is not yet in CISA's KEV catalog, but a public advisory exists and EPSS assigns a high 71.1% probability of exploitation within 30 days (99th percentile), indicating elevated near-term risk.

Do: Upgrade to LibreNMS 24.10.0 or later. Until patched, restrict API token creation to trusted users and review existing tokens for unexpected or script-bearing values, removing or rotating any suspicious ones. Because injected scripts execute in other users' sessions, also review user activity logs for unexpected actions following recent token creation.

Stored XSS in LibreNMS Alert Rules lets authenticated users hijack sessions

LibreNMS, an open-source PHP/MySQL/SNMP-based network monitoring system, contains a stored cross-site scripting (XSS) flaw (CWE-79) in its Alert Rules feature. An authenticated user can inject arbitrary JavaScript into the 'Title' field of an alert rule; the script then executes in the browsers of other users who view that rule, running in the context of their sessions. Successful exploitation can compromise other users' accounts and enable unauthorized actions within LibreNMS, though the network vector requires low privileges and user interaction (CVSS 3.1: 5.4, Scope: Changed). All LibreNMS deployments running versions before 24.9.0 are affected, with internet-exposed instances facing the greatest risk from lower-privileged or malicious insiders and compromised accounts. As of now there is no CISA KEV listing, but one public reference (the GitHub security advisory GHSA-j2j9-7pr6-xqwv) documents the issue, and EPSS assigns a relatively high 29.6% probability of exploitation within 30 days.

Do: Upgrade LibreNMS to 24.9.0 or later, which fixes the issue. Until then, restrict creation and editing of Alert Rules to trusted administrator accounts, review existing alert rule titles for injected HTML/JavaScript, and consider sanitizing the Title field at the web application firewall or reverse-proxy layer for internet-exposed instances.

LibreNMS is an open-source, PHP/MySQL/SNMP-based network monitoring system. A SQL injection vulnerability in POST /search/search=packages in LibreNMS prior to version 24.4.0 allows a user with global read privileges to execute SQL commands via the package parameter. With this vulnerability, an attacker can exploit a SQL injection time based vulnerability to extract all data from the database, such as administrator credentials. Version 24.4.0 contains a patch for the vulnerability.

LibreNMS is an auto-discovering PHP/MySQL/SNMP based network monitoring which includes support for a wide range of network hardware and operating systems. In affected versions of LibreNMS when a user accesses their device dashboard, one request is sent to `graph.php` to access graphs generated on the particular Device. This request can be accessed by a low privilege user and they can enumerate devices on librenms with their id or hostname. Leveraging this vulnerability a low privilege user can see all devices registered by admin users. This vulnerability has been addressed in commit `489978a923` which has been included in release version 23.11.0. Users are advised to upgrade. There are no known workarounds for this vulnerability.
